I have some recruiting, and publicity opportunity ideas! :-) First idea I have is that there are A LOT of colleges and universities within Ansteorra. Find out which ones have history clubs, gaming clubs, or even see how active their history and theatre departments are. Then see if we can do a demo on campus, and if they have organizations that have common interests, see about meeting or invite them to an event or something. The ultimate-long term-goal is collaboration, and hey, maybe even getting a group started on campus.. Next idea.. contact your local newspapers, news channels or cable access... invite them to an event, to have them cover it, take pictures, coordinate interviews with key people.. I did this when I lived in the Far West, and they absolutely loved it. The reporters really got into it, taking pictures (they got some really cool shots, too), talking to people...We got some great exposure (2 full page COLOR story). Next idea.. Go to the local libraries and put up flyers, and even have a demo there.. I great time would be during history month or something. Next idea.. it seems that fighter practices are where we get the most regular public visibility. So, have one practice a month that's a "mini-demo".. everyone (even people who aren't fighting) come in garb and bring some things to display, have informational flyers, business cards, and a sign up sheed.... Have banners flying (if we don't have banners.. let's make some!)... Be noticed! In my opinion, I think a perfect opportunity (in Central Region at least) to do this would be during joint war practices, because of all the people who show up. Does anyone have any ideas for recruiting? I've been checking around for Renfairs in the state, and there are at least a dozen. Why don't we have groups out there recruiting? Obviously those people are interested in the middle ages, they're going to fair aren't they? Constance is working with the SMU Medieval Studies club and trying to get people from there. The school has a degree program in Medieval Studies. Why aren't they ALL members? I don't think you can get more interested people than those that have plan to devote their careers to the study of medieval history. In Caid, when each of the Lord of the Rings movies came out they put groups in many theaters, in garb, to spread the word. It worked out well too. We should be doing that whenever a medieval movie comes out. Who knows, the theater manager might even be nice enough to give us free tickets and munchies like they did for LOTR. :-) Are there Octoberfest celebrations around here? What other festivals could we benefit from? Vicar Miguel had the idea of forming dedicated "demo parties" that would have a wealth of information available to them, good quality garb, and much information to share that could go to different events, set up a table, and recruit.
